Summary, notice description and lot information
The Norfolk and Norwich University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ust is currently in the award stage of a procurement process entitled "Storage and Distribution of Cellular Therapy Products Autologous Service Provision," which falls under blood analysis services within the healthcare sector. This process, guided by the Health Care Services Provider Selection Regime Regulations 2023, has identified NHS Blood and Transplant (NHSBT) as the intended provider. The trust is based in Norwich, UK, and the region served is UKH1.
This contract, valued at approximately £200,000, is set to commence on 1st February 2026 and conclude on 31st March 2027. The procurement method used is a limited one, specifically an award procedure without a prior call for competition, due to its status as a Provider Selection Regime contract. Services to include processing and storage of stem cells<br/><br/>This notice is an intention to award a contract under the PSR Most Suitable Provider process.<br/>The approximate lifetime value of this contract will be PS200,000.<br/><br/>This is an existing service<br/>This will be a new provider<br/>The services will be provided between 1st February 2026 and 31st March 2027.
